As a Senior Design Reliability Engineer at Impulse, you will own the standardization and implementation of Impulse’s design process. You will lead cross-functional efforts on setting design standards, margining approach, configuration management, and templates.

Responsibilities
  • Define and document design standards and best practices for structures, propulsion, avionics, composites, mechanisms, and more
  • Define and document our margining approach
  • Own the design release workflow processes, from CAD to PLM to MRP and ERP
  • Define the design review process, templates, and milestones
  • Create and manage tools to compile design-informing data and information, traceability of changes, and key decision points
  • Provide design-for-reliability guidance during design reviews and build planning
  • Develop and implement robust design configuration management processes
  • Use build and flight data to influence requirements, assumptions, and decisions
  • Act as a specification custodian for our design, margining, configuration, and release processes
  • Ensure product integrity by holding the line on quality standards, extreme-owning design containments, and driving corrective actions to completion
  • Liaise with build reliability, quality, and flight reliability to solve problems together

Minimum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, or related field
  • 5+ years of experience in hardware design and analysis for aerospace, automotive, or high-reliability systems
  • Demonstrated experience supporting design-for-manufacturing of builds, integration, or test of primary structures and/or complex mechanical or electromechanical systems
  • Strong problem-solving skills with demonstrated root cause analysis experience
  • Strong theoretical and working knowledge of GD&T

Preferred Skills and Experience
  • 8+ years of demonstrated design reliability experience with spacecraft, launch vehicles, aviation, robotics, or hardware
  • Familiarity with AS9100, ISO 9001, or similar quality systems (practical application preferred over documentation focus)
  • Demonstrated experience with reliability engineering concepts (FMEA, reliability growth, Weibull analysis)
  • Demonstrated background working closely with cross-functional teams
  • Demonstrated experience supporting rapid development or prototype-to-production transitions

About
Impulse Space, the in-space transportation company founded by Tom Mueller, is opening access beyond Low Earth Orbit (LEO) with its fleet of in-space transportation vehicles. The high-energy Helios vehicle unlocks orbits beyond LEO with its powerful Deneb engine, dropping off payloads in MEO, GEO, heliocentric, lunar, and other planetary orbits. The flight-proven Mira vehicle uses a nontoxic, high-impulse chemical propulsion system to offer orbital transport, constellation deployment, and precision reentry services to customers throughout LEO. Led by a team that delivered the most reliable rockets in history, Impulse provides economical and efficient in-space transportation by reliably and rapidly getting customers where they want to go.
